99. With reference to the Biofuture Platform,
consider the following statements:
1. It focuses towards developing solutions
in low carbon transport and bioeconomy.
2. It has been setup under the aegis of the
United Nations Environment Programme
(UNEP).
3. India is not a member of the Biofuture
platform.
Which of the statements given above is/are
correct?
(a) 1 and 2 only
(b) 1 only
(c) 1 and 3 only
(d) 2 and 3 only
